    If you want a beach holiday with rocky walks and scenery thrown in then this is a good place. Easy bus ride away (two an hour) is the Giant’s Causeway. The helpful tourist office in the town hall has timetables and can tell you where the bus stop is as it’s located in an odd place. Not so much to do in wet weather conditions but good places to eat that had plenty of room.

    Lovely town on the North Coast to base yourself for all the excursions around. Fantastic beaches and plenty of good food places. Weather can change at a moments notice with sun,rain and the wrath of the Atlantic all in a day,come prepared. If you golf there are excellent golf courses.
